summaryrefslogtreecommitdiff
path: root/chromium/third_party/blink/renderer/platform/cross_thread_copier.h
diff options
context:
space:
mode:
Diffstat (limited to 'chromium/third_party/blink/renderer/platform/cross_thread_copier.h')
-rw-r--r--chromium/third_party/blink/renderer/platform/cross_thread_copier.h7
1 files changed, 7 insertions, 0 deletions
diff --git a/chromium/third_party/blink/renderer/platform/cross_thread_copier.h b/chromium/third_party/blink/renderer/platform/cross_thread_copier.h
index 738ceed65ed..4c14240beb2 100644
--- a/chromium/third_party/blink/renderer/platform/cross_thread_copier.h
+++ b/chromium/third_party/blink/renderer/platform/cross_thread_copier.h
@@ -183,6 +183,13 @@ struct CrossThreadCopier<
};
template <wtf_size_t inlineCapacity, typename Allocator>
+struct CrossThreadCopier<Vector<uint8_t, inlineCapacity, Allocator>> {
+ STATIC_ONLY(CrossThreadCopier);
+ using Type = Vector<uint8_t, inlineCapacity, Allocator>;
+ static Type Copy(Type value) { return value; }
+};
+
+template <wtf_size_t inlineCapacity, typename Allocator>
struct CrossThreadCopier<Vector<uint64_t, inlineCapacity, Allocator>> {
STATIC_ONLY(CrossThreadCopier);
using Type = Vector<uint64_t, inlineCapacity, Allocator>;